Strategy Games Market Analysis 2024-2025

Strategy Games 2024-2025: When Legacy Franchises Stumble and Indie Hits Soar

The 2024-2025 period shook the strategy gaming world in ways few predicted. Major franchises stumbled badly while unexpected newcomers claimed the spotlight. The data tells a fascinating story about what players actually want versus what big studios thought they wanted. The Numbers Don’t Lie: Critics Loved It, Players Hated It Two of the year’s biggest releases reveal a stunning disconnect. Civilization VII scored a respectable 79 from critics but crashed to a dismal 3.7 user score with “Mixed” Steam reviews at 49%. Homeworld 3 followed the same pattern: 75 critic score versus 3.0 from users, landing at just 41% positive on Steam. ...

Grand Theft Auto VI Delayed to November 2026

Grand Theft Auto VI Delayed Again: November 2026 Release Confirmed

Rockstar Games has officially pushed back the release of Grand Theft Auto VI to November 19, 2026, marking another significant delay in what has become one of the most anticipated video game launches in history. This latest adjustment extends the wait by several months from the previously announced May 2026 window, which itself was a delay from the original late 2025 timeframe.
